Pakistan not invited for Azlan Shah Cup because of 'outstanding debt'

NEW DELHI: The Malaysian Hockey Federation has not extended an invitation to Pakistan for this year’s Azlan Shah Cup in November due to an “outstanding debt.”
“A former official of the PHF made some bad decisions during the last Azlan Shah Cup which left the PHF in debt to the MHF,” a source in the Pakistan Hockey Federation (PHF) said.
As a result, the Malaysian organizers were “not happy” with the situation and did not invite Pakistan, despite their runner-up finish in last year’s tournament.
The source added that PHF officials were working to resolve the issue with the Malaysian Hockey Federation and were hopeful that an invitation would still be sent later this week.
“Pakistan and Malaysia have very strong hockey ties built over the years, and this issue should be sorted out,” he said.
Meanwhile, defending champions Japan will not participate in this year’s edition due to prior commitments.
